CITY OF LONG BEACH WEDNESDAY, OCTOBER 18, 2017 SENIOR CITIZEN ADVISORY LONG BEACH SENIOR CENTER COMMISSION MINUTES 1150 EAST 4TH STREET, ROOM 202, LONG BEACH, CA 90802, 9:00 AM Mary Alice Sedillo, Chair Robert Finney, Commissioner Winifred W. Carter, Commissioner Jo Prabhu, Commissioner Laura E. Claveran, Commissioner Paula Prager, Commissioner Don Darnauer, Commissioner Naida Tushnet, Commissioner Ronald Eomurian, Commissioner 1 ROLL CALL At 9:03 a.m., Commissioner Sedillo called the meeting to order. STAFF LIAISON Lori Jarmacz, Superintendent Irene Rodriguez, Secretary PLEDGE OF ALLEGIANCE Commissioner Tushnet led the flag salute. READING OF MISSION STATEMENT Commissioner Eomurian read the mission statement. 2 APPROVAL OF MINUTES 17-010SR Recommendation to approve the minutes of the Senior Citizens Advisory Commission minutes for the meeting held September 20, 2017. Suggested Action: Approve recommendation. A motion was made Commissioner Robert Finney, seconded by Commissioner Paula Prager, to approve recommendation. The motion carried by the following vote: Yes: 7 - Don Darnauer, Ronald Eomurian, Robert Finney, Jo Prabhu, Paula Prager, Naida Tushnet and Mary Sedillo Page 1 of 4 CITY OF LONG BEACH WEDNESDAY, OCTOBER 18, 2017 SENIOR CITIZEN ADVISORY LONG BEACH SENIOR CENTER COMMISSION MINUTES 1150 EAST 4TH STREET, ROOM 202, LONG BEACH, CA 90802, 9:00 AM Excused: 1 - Winifred Carter Absent: 1 - Laura Claveran 3 PUBLIC PARTICIPATION Patron, Richard Castle attended the Long Beach Transit Board meeting on September 25th as requested by Commissioner Darnauer. There will be another important Transit meeting on October 23rd at the Long Beach Transit. 4 GUEST SPEAKER Guest speaker, Jacqueline Lauder, MSG, Director Community Giving with SCAN Health Plan gave a presentation on independence at home and services SCAN has to offer seniors. 5 STAFF REPORT Recreation Superintendent, Lori Jarmacz invited everyone to attend the Long Beach Senior Center Health & Wellness Fair October 24th from 9am-12noon where they awill be offering FREE Flu shots to Seniors. Listed are "FREE" Flu clinics/locations that will run from 9am-12noon: 11/01 Mc Bride Park - 155 Martin Luther King Jr. Ave. LB 11/03 El Dorado Park - 2800 Studebaker Road LB 11/06 Bixby Park - 130 Cherry Avenue LB 11/08 Houghton Park - 6301 Myrtle Ave. LB Recreation Superintendent, Lori Jarmacz advised the Senior Citizen Advisory Commission they will be conducting elections for new officers at the November Meeting. Page 2 of 4 CITY OF LONG BEACH WEDNESDAY, OCTOBER 18, 2017 SENIOR CITIZEN ADVISORY LONG BEACH SENIOR CENTER COMMISSION MINUTES 1150 EAST 4TH STREET, ROOM 202, LONG BEACH, CA 90802, 9:00 AM 6 STANDING COMMITTEE REPORTS A. Community Relations - Commissioners Darnauer, Finney and Prager Commissioner Darnauer reported on a presentation that was submitted by the Downtown Residential Council to expand the Passport bus route. B. Crime Prevention and Safety - Commissioners Carter, Eomurian and Prabhu - None C. Health - Commissioners Sedillo and Prager Commissioner Sedillo reported on lecture she attended on "CKD" Kidneys. Commissioner Sedillo reported on a Nursing home and medicare article. D. Housing - Commissioners Sedillo, Darnauer and Tushnet Commissioner Sedillo reported that the Granny Flats development passed. Commissioner Darnauer reported on a recent Hi-rise building survey. E. Legislation - Commissioner Finney - None F. Technology - Commissioner Prabhu Commissioner Prabhu reported on a meeting she will be having with Heart of Ida to discuss Senior Technology/Training. G. Transportation - Commissioners Darnauer, Finney, Eomurian and Prabhu Commissioner Darnauer reported on an appointment with Council member Gonzalez and Kraig Kogan regarding the Passport bus expansion, he also has a meeting with Mayor Garcia scheduled for next week. Page 3 of 4 CITY OF LONG BEACH WEDNESDAY, OCTOBER 18, 2017 SENIOR CITIZEN ADVISORY LONG BEACH SENIOR CENTER COMMISSION MINUTES 1150 EAST 4TH STREET, ROOM 202, LONG BEACH, CA 90802, 9:00 AM 7 ANNOUNCEMENTS First District Councilwoman, Lena Gonzalez will be hosting a Dia De Los Muertos Celebration in downtown Long Beach on November 4th. Moola will be hosting a Dia De Los Muertos Celebration on October 21st. Gray Panthers will be hosting a Holiday Brunch on December 2nd from 11am-2pm at Plymouth West 240 Chestnut Avenue in Long Beach. Landuse Planning Meeting at Scherer Park on October 18th @ 6 pm. Aquarium of the Pacific is starting an Enviromental Academy on October 25th. Cost: 4 wks/$40 The General meeting of the Senior Citizen Advisory Commission will be held November 15, 2017 at 9:00 am, at Long Beach Senior Center located at 1150 E. 4th Street Room #202, Long Beach 90802. ADJOURNMENT At 10:44 a.m., Commissioner Sedillo adjourned the meeting. Page 4 of 4
